This is surreal: 2026 BMW M2 CS Power Revealed!

In a surprising twist, the highly-anticipated 2026 BMW M2 CS may pack a whopping 525 horsepower under its hood. Although this information should be taken with a grain of salt, it’s worth noting that if these numbers are accurate, the M2 CS will be a force to be reckoned with.

According to a Bimmerpost member, the M2 CS will feature pure rear-wheel drive, which comes as no surprise to enthusiasts. Additionally, instead of offering both a 6-speed manual and 8-speed DCT transmission, BMW will reportedly equip the M2 CS with a two-pedal unit exclusively.

Comparing it to its predecessor, the 2025 BMW M2 Coupe, the M2 CS seems to have a significant advantage in terms of power. With 525 horsepower, it outshines the M2 Coupe’s 473 horsepower, making it a true performance beast. This power boost places the M2 CS in direct competition with the larger and more expensive M4 CSL, which boasts an impressive 542 horsepower.

Not only will the M2 CS be a powerhouse, but it’s also expected to be lighter and more agile than its predecessor. With a sprint time of 0-62 mph in just 3.7 seconds, the M2 CS will leave its competitors in the dust. Furthermore, reports suggest that the M2 CS will feature a carbon fiber roof, an Alcantara-wrapped steering wheel, and a sportier design compared to the standard M2.

While the release date for the M2 CS remains uncertain, sources indicate that it may not hit the market until next summer. However, enthusiasts can expect it to be available in limited numbers for the 2026 model year. As for the price, it’s anticipated to be higher than the standard M2, which starts at $64,900.
